About rent and a nursing assistant salary
Nursing assistant (CNA) pay falls below the rent threshold for a one-bedroom in nearly every US metro, which is the central tension behind the widely studied direct-care workforce affordability gap. At the national-average CNA salary, the 30% rule supports about $990 a month in rent — below median rent in most cities. The per-city pages quantify how far below.

Can a nursing assistant afford rent in Weatherford, TX?
Median rent in Weatherford is $1,509 a month. A typical nursing assistant in Texas earns about $39,214 a year, which makes that rent 46.2% of gross monthly income. Under the 30% rule, the answer is no — rent exceeds the 30% threshold.
How much rent can a nursing assistant afford in Weatherford?
Using the 30% rule, a nursing assistant salary in Texas (~$39,214/yr) supports up to $980 a month in rent. Weatherford's current median rent is $1,509/mo, which is $529/mo over the affordability threshold.
How many hours does a nursing assistant work to cover rent in Weatherford?
At an hourly equivalent of about $19 an hour, a nursing assistant in Texas works roughly 80 hours a month to cover Weatherford's median rent of $1,509.
